> > >>> Hi to all
> > >>>
> > >>> I have a thinkpad Notebook, running still Win XP Pro.
> > >>> Now about two days ago there was this new itunes update
> > available. Ok, I
> > >>> thought I could install it.
> > >>> So I did and after that I can't connect to the internet
> > anymore with any
> > >>> browser. I only use wired LAN-connection.
> > >>>
> > >>> I reinstalled the Ethernet Adapter, tried different ethernet cables.
> > >>> I even did a reset of the windows system on partition C, which
> > >> was mirrored
> > >>> a few years ago.
> > >>> No chance.
> > >>>
> > >>> I know the most of you are apple people which probably don't
> > >> have much to do
> > >>> with windows anymore. But maybe you can give me some advice.
> > >>> I still can access the LAN from computer to another. but I
> > can't open a
> > >>> webpage anymore. It just says that I don't have connection.
> > >>> Maybe you know what itunes is doing and how I could fix it.
